with N-(oxopyrrolin-4-yl)-3-chloromethylbenzonitriles provides 5-substituted aminopyrrolo[3,4-b]quinolines by an overall single-pot, tandem alkylation/cyclization sequence. Mechanistic considerations suggest an in situ–generated ortho-quinone methide imine (aza-ortho-xylylene) as a reactive intermediate, which may trap an alkyl group from the diorganozinc reagent by a conjugate addition.
